1 / 8
文档名称:

基于深度学习的立体匹配算法研究.docx

格式:docx   大小:27KB   页数:8页
下载后只包含 1 个 DOCX 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

基于深度学习的立体匹配算法研究.docx

上传人:zzz 2025/5/16 文件大小:27 KB

下载得到文件列表

基于深度学习的立体匹配算法研究.docx

相关文档

文档介绍

文档介绍:该【基于深度学习的立体匹配算法研究 】是由【zzz】上传分享,文档一共【8】页,该文档可以免费在线阅读,需要了解更多关于【基于深度学习的立体匹配算法研究 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。基于深度学习的立体匹配算法研究
一、引言
随着深度学习技术的快速发展,其在计算机视觉领域的应用越来越广泛。立体匹配作为三维重建和自主驾驶等领域的核心问题,其算法的准确性和效率直接影响到这些应用的实际效果。因此,本文提出基于深度学习的立体匹配算法研究,以期为该领域的进步做出一定的贡献。
二、背景及意义
立体匹配算法的核心目的是根据两个或多个视图的信息来获取深度信息,实现三维场景的重建。传统的立体匹配算法大多依赖于图像的特征提取和匹配,但这种方法在处理复杂场景和动态环境时,往往难以达到理想的匹配效果。而深度学习技术的出现,为立体匹配算法提供了新的思路和方法。通过深度学习技术,可以自动学习和提取图像中的深层特征,提高匹配的准确性和鲁棒性。
三、深度学习在立体匹配中的应用
1. 深度学习模型选择:卷积神经网络(CNN)在图像处理方面具有显著优势,其在立体匹配算法中的应用也越来越广泛。通过设计合理的网络结构,可以有效地提取图像中的特征,提高匹配的准确性和效率。
2. 特征提取与匹配:基于深度学习的立体匹配算法,通过训练模型自动学习和提取图像中的深层特征,然后利用这些特征进行匹配。与传统方法相比,这种方法可以更好地处理复杂场景和动态环境。
3. 损失函数设计:在训练过程中,损失函数的设计对模型的性能至关重要。针对立体匹配任务,需要设计合适的损失函数来衡量预测深度与实际深度之间的差异,从而优化模型参数。
四、基于深度学习的立体匹配算法研究
本文提出一种基于深度学习的立体匹配算法,具体步骤如下:
1. 数据集准备:收集大量包含立体图像对的训练数据集,用于训练模型。
2. 模型设计:设计合理的卷积神经网络结构,包括卷积层、池化层、全连接层等,以提取图像中的深层特征。
3. 特征提取与匹配:利用训练好的模型提取图像中的特征,然后根据特征进行匹配。在匹配过程中,采用合适的损失函数来优化模型参数。
4. 实验与结果分析:在测试数据集上验证算法的性能,包括准确率、鲁棒性、时间复杂度等方面。与传统的立体匹配算法进行对比,分析基于深度学习的立体匹配算法的优越性和局限性。
五、实验与结果分析
本部分详细描述了实验过程和结果分析。首先,介绍了实验环境、数据集以及对比算法等相关信息。然后,通过实验验证了本文提出的基于深度学习的立体匹配算法在准确率、鲁棒性、时间复杂度等方面的性能。与传统的立体匹配算法相比,本文提出的算法在处理复杂场景和动态环境时表现出更好的性能。此外,还对算法的局限性进行了分析,为未来的研究提供了方向。
六、结论与展望
本文研究了基于深度学习的立体匹配算法,通过设计合理的卷积神经网络结构和损失函数,提高了匹配的准确性和鲁棒性。实验结果表明,本文提出的算法在处理复杂场景和动态环境时表现出较好的性能。然而,仍存在一些局限性,如对大规模数据集的依赖、计算资源的需求等。未来,我们将继续研究更高效的立体匹配算法,进一步提高匹配的准确性和效率,为三维重建和自主驾驶等领域的应用提供更好的支持。
总之,基于深度学习的立体匹配算法研究具有重要的理论意义和应用价值。通过不断的研究和改进,我们将为计算机视觉领域的发展做出更大的贡献。
七、相关研究回顾
在这一部分中,我们将回顾当前在基于深度学习的立体匹配算法领域的其它重要研究工作。这些研究为我们提供了灵感,同时也让我们看到了一些现有研究的局限性和可改进的方面。我们将概述这些算法的基本思想、使用的主要技术、以及他们的优点和不足。此外,我们将对这些算法与本文所提方法进行比较,以便更清楚地展现本文算法的独特之处。
八、算法细节分析
本部分将详细阐述本文提出的基于深度学习的立体匹配算法的细节。这包括但不限于神经网络的结构设计、训练过程中的损失函数选择、优化策略、数据预处理和后处理等步骤。我们将详细解释每个步骤的目的、实现方法和其对于提高立体匹配准确性和鲁棒性的作用。
九、实验设计与方法
本部分将详细描述实验设计和实施方法。首先,我们将介绍所使用的数据集,包括其来源、规模和特性。接着,我们将详细描述实验的设计,包括如何将数据集划分为训练集、验证集和测试集,以及如何设置实验参数等。此外,我们还将介绍对比实验的设计,包括与哪些传统立体匹配算法进行对比,以及如何评估各种算法的性能。
十、实验结果与讨论
本部分将详细展示实验结果,并进行深入的讨论。我们将展示本文提出的算法在准确率、鲁棒性、时间复杂度等方面的性能,并将其与传统的立体匹配算法进行对比。此外,我们还将对实验结果进行深入的分析和讨论,探讨算法的优越性和局限性,并分析可能的原因。
十一、局限性分析
在深度学习的立体匹配算法中,虽然我们已经取得了显著的成果,但仍存在一些局限性。本部分将详细分析这些局限性,包括对大规模数据集的依赖、对计算资源的需求、对复杂场景和动态环境的处理能力等。这些局限性是我们未来研究的重要方向。
十二、未来研究方向
在最后一部分中,我们将展望未来的研究方向。基于当前的研究成果和局限性分析,我们将提出一些可能的改进方向和研究重点。这包括但不限于开发更高效的神经网络结构、使用更强大的优化策略、提高算法对复杂场景和动态环境的处理能力等。我们相信,通过不断的研究和改进,我们将能够进一步提高基于深度学习的立体匹配算法的性能,为三维重建和自主驾驶等领域的应用提供更好的支持。
十三、总结与展望
在总结部分,我们将对全文进行回顾和总结,强调本文的主要贡献和创新点。同时,我们也将对未来的研究方向进行展望,以期为该领域的研究者提供一些启示和参考。我们相信,通过不断的研究和努力,基于深度学习的立体匹配算法将在计算机视觉领域发挥更大的作用,为人类的生活带来更多的便利和价值。
十四、算法优越性探讨
深度学习的立体匹配算法在众多领域展现出了显著的优越性。首先,它能够通过学习大量数据中的模式和规律,自动提取图像中的特征,从而提高了匹配的准确性和稳定性。其次,深度学习算法能够处理复杂的场景和动态环境,对于光照变化、遮挡、噪声等干扰因素具有较强的鲁棒性。此外,深度学习算法还可以通过不断学习和优化,逐步提高其性能,使得立体匹配的精度和速度都得到了显著的提升。
十五、算法局限性分析
尽管深度学习的立体匹配算法取得了显著的成果,但仍存在一些局限性。首先,该算法对大规模数据集的依赖性较强。为了训练出高性能的模型,需要大量的标注数据,这增加了数据收集和处理的成本。其次,该算法对计算资源的需求较高。深度学习模型的训练和推理都需要强大的计算设备,这对于一些资源有限的场景来说是一个挑战。此外,对于复杂场景和动态环境的处理能力还有待提高。尽管深度学习算法具有一定的鲁棒性,但仍难以应对一些极端的场景和动态变化的情况。
十六、可能的原因分析
十六、可能的原因分析
基于深度学习的立体匹配算法研究的内容之所以面临局限性和挑战,有以下几个可能的原因:
首先,数据集的复杂性和多样性问题。虽然深度学习算法需要大量的数据来训练模型,但是数据的多样性和复杂性直接影响了算法的泛化能力。如果数据集的场景、光照、遮挡等条件过于单一,那么训练出的模型可能无法很好地适应复杂多变的环境。因此,高质量的数据集是提高算法性能的关键因素之一。
其次,算法的复杂性和计算资源问题。深度学习模型通常包含大量的参数和计算操作,这使得模型训练和推理都需要较高的计算资源。然而,在实际应用中,尤其是对于资源有限的场景,可能无法提供足够的计算设备和存储空间来支持高复杂度的模型。因此,如何降低模型的复杂度、优化算法的效率,是当前研究的重要方向。
此外,动态环境和实时性要求也是影响立体匹配算法性能的重要因素。在实际应用中,场景的变化和动态环境对算法的实时性和准确性提出了更高的要求。然而,当前的深度学习算法在处理动态环境和实时性要求方面还存在一定的挑战。这需要我们在算法设计和优化上做出更多的努力,以提高算法的适应性和实时性。
十七、未来研究方向
针对上述问题和挑战,未来深度学习的立体匹配算法研究可以从以下几个方面展开:
首先,进一步优化数据集的构建和标注。通过增加数据集的多样性和复杂性,提高模型的泛化能力,使其能够更好地适应各种复杂场景。
其次,研究更高效的算法和模型结构。通过优化模型的复杂度、降低计算资源的消耗,使得算法可以在更多的场景下应用。
再次,结合其他技术手段提高算法的鲁棒性。例如,可以结合多模态信息、上下文信息等来提高算法在复杂环境和动态变化情况下的处理能力。
最后,加强与其他领域的交叉研究。例如,可以与计算机图形学、人工智能等领域进行交叉研究,共同推动立体匹配算法的发展和应用。
总之,尽管深度学习的立体匹配算法在计算机视觉领域已经取得了显著的成果,但仍需进一步研究和改进。通过不断努力和探索,相信这种算法将在未来为人类的生活带来更多的便利和价值。